Boynton OK with Martin’s staffing decisions

Published: April 3, 2012 

Although the university has not made it official, new basketball coach Frank Martin plans to bring his entire coaching staff from Kansas State to join him next season at South Carolina, former assistant coach Mike Boynton said Tuesday during an interview with 560 The Team.

Boynton would have considered staying with the Gamecocks but applauded Martin’s decision, he said.

“It’s the right thing to do,” Boynton, who was on Darrin Horn’s staff for four seasons before Horn was fired last month, told the radio station. “Frank Martin made the right decision in being loyal to the guys who helped him get to this position. I have total respect for what he has done.”

Brad Underwood, who could not be reached for comment, was on Martin’s staff all five years Martin was at Kansas State and served as the Wildcats’ director of basketball operations for one season under Bob Huggins. Underwood was Martin’s associate head coach last season. Underwood has previously been the head coach at Daytona Beach Community College and an assistant at Western Illinois.

Matt Figger also spent five seasons under Martin at Kansas State and was the Wildcats’ recruiting coordinator. He coached for five seasons under John Pelphrey at South Alabama.
